Output 62e27713ef0560c7dadd87587a2e3c74bd740b2f6a071e3331dd58557e528278:0

value
5109415
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b43ffbb12c56e29a4a486c01bcaca0aeae78862f OP_EQUALVERIFY OP_CHECKSIG
address
1HS5HABF2yKvrKDazH1XbAP124kFZAAkJP
transaction
62e27713ef0560c7dadd87587a2e3c74bd740b2f6a071e3331dd58557e528278
spent
true